According to YG Entertainment on the 8th, BLACKPINK's "Playing with Fire" music video surpassed 900 million views on YouTube at around 4:41 am on the same day. It is a record of about 8 years and 1 month since its release on November 1, 2016.
"Playing with Fire" is one of the double title songs of BLACKPINK's second digital single. With witty lyrics that compare a girl in love to "playing with fire" and the powerful performance of the four members, it gained popularity.
With this record, BLACKPINK has 12 videos with over 900 million views out of a total of 47 billion-view content. Previously, there were "DDU-DU DDU-DU" (2.2 billion views), "Kill This Love" (2 billion views), "BOOMBAYAH" (1.7 billion views), "How You Like That" performance video and music video (both 1.7 billion views), "As If It's Your Last" (1.4 billion views), Lisa's solo song "MONEY" exclusive performance video (1 billion views), Jenny's solo song "SOLO" (1 billion views), "Ice Cream" (900 million views), "Pink Venom" music video (900 million views), and "Whistle" music video (900 million views).
BLACKPINK continues to set unparalleled records as the "YouTube Queen," with their YouTube channel subscribers reaching 95.3 million, the highest number among male and female artists worldwide, and their cumulative channel views exceeding 37.5 billion.
